Job Summary

The Tennessee World Affairs Council seeks a contract technical support specialist to organize, manage, maintain, and operate the TNWAC computer/virtual-based systems such as the TNWAC.org Web site, member and event databases, Zoom media, social media, newsletter services, email hosting, and related technical applications and media.

40 hours per month

Job Responsibilities

  • Maintained the TNWAC.org website (WordPress)including Webmaster duties such as: managing the hosting account; fixing Website errors; processing posts, pages, and other content; coordinating site updates; and compiling analytics.
  • Manage the TNWAC Little Green Light donor/event management program. 
  • Manage the TNWAC mail service, Mailchimp, including uploading outgoing newsletters and other media; maintain subscriber base; update template designs.
  • Manage the TNWAC external media applications; design content and post to TNWAC social media accounts. 
  • Assist TNWAC staff with Zoom meetings and webinars.
  • Manage TNWAC video, Podcast, and transcript services: record and perform post-production work to create content from TNWAC virtual and in-person events.
  • Manage posting and distribution of “Weekly Quiz” via Quiz-Maker, website, Mailchimp, and email to subscribers, to meet weekly production deadlines.
  • Maintain TNWAC Google Workspace email accounts management.
  • Assist TNWAC staff with technical support and advice

Qualifications

Demonstrated proficiency in website management, WordPress; Zoom; and social media content. Experience with or ability and readiness to learn TNWAC-specific applications and systems such as Little Green Light and Mailchimp.

Candidates should be team-oriented and have an interest in the TNWAC mission and an interest in knowing about the world.

Experience: One year experience and/or demonstrated proficiency in required skills
